Web Admin Port
These fields are for specifying the port number at which the Web Admin Interface can be
accessible.
Web Admin Access
This
option is for specifying the network interfaces through which the Web Admin Interface
can be accessible:
LAN only
LAN/WAN
If LAN/WAN is chosen, a WAN Connection Access Settings form will be displayed.
WAN Connection Access Settings
Allowed Source IP
Subnets
This field allows you to restrict web admin access only from defined IP subnets.
Any - Allow web admin accesses to be from anywhere, without IP address
restriction.
Allow access from the following IP subnets only - Restrict web admin access
only from the defined IP subnets. When this is chosen, a text input area will be
displayed beneath:
The allowed IP subnet addresses should be entered into this text area. Each IP subnet
must be in form of w.x.y.z/m
where
w.x.y.z is an IP address (e.g. 192.168.0.0), and
m is the subnet mask in CIDR format, which is between 0 and 32 inclusively. For example:
192.168.0.0/24
To define multiple subnets, separate each IP subnet one in a line.
For example:
192.168.0.0/24
10.8.0.0/16
Allowed WAN IP
Address(es)
This is to choose which WAN IP address(es) the web server should listen on.
